DescriptionProgram: Bharatanatya Arangetram of Srinidhi Nambirajan, July 27, 2008. This was the first performance of the apprentice, in India, before she was in the CCHAP program.
NotesSubject Note: The Southern New England Traditional Arts Apprenticeship Program is a CCHAP initiative since 1997 that connects artists in Connecticut, Massachusetts, and Rhode Island to teach and learn community-based folk and traditional art forms. Support has been provided by the National Endowment for the Arts, the Connecticut Commission on the Arts, the Institute for Community Research, and the Connecticut Historical Society.

Biographical Note: Srinidhi Nambirajan was a student of Bharata Natyam dance. In the Apprenticeship program she was mentored by teacher Sridevi Thirumalai. In her required public presnetation, the 15 year old apprentice performed a story piece from the Ramayanam epic, requiring strong expressive qualities as well as dance technique, supported by her mother as singer and a group of excellent musicians led by the master teacher. Srinidhi collaborated with CT Tamil Sangam on the event, raising $3500 for education in South India.
